Seek immediate medical attention if you experience: Severe abdominal pain that is persistent, worsening, or accompanied by fever Obstipation (complete inability to pass stool or gas) with progressive abdominal distension Rectal bleeding or black, tarry stools, which may indicate gastrointestinal bleeding Persistent nausea and vomiting that prevents adequate fluid intake, risking dehydration Signs of bowel obstruction including severe cramping, visible abdominal swelling, and complete cessation of bowel movements Schedule a routine appointment if: Constipation persists despite conservative management measures for more than two weeks You require regular use of stimulant laxatives to maintain bowel function Constipation significantly impacts your quality of life or medication adherence You experience new or worsening hemorrhoids related to straining You have questions about adjusting your tirzepatide dose due to gastrointestinal side effects Your healthcare provider can assess whether dose adjustment, temporary treatment interruption, or alternative management strategies are appropriate
